Toys
It's time to dig into those toy boxes and see what illegal contraband
has been smuggled in. We find that Barbie shoes and small rubber balls
seem to magically make their way into our younger boys toy boxes. Are
smaller toys that are OK for your 5 or 6 year old stored up high
away from your 2 year old? Have you dumped out your little ones toy
boxes to see what lurks down at the bottom? A part of last weeks
dinner. A tippy cup that didn't get accounted for. A ring that your
older daughter got for her birthday. Take a look at the toys and make
sure that no parts have come loose or broken off. It never ceases to
